Another chance to ride your bike on the West Seattle Bridge: Cascade’s Emerald City Ride returns this April
(May 2024 photo by Allyne Armitage) Thanks for the tip! The Cascade Bicycle Club is bringing back the Emerald City Ride, and it again will briefly close the westbound West Seattle Bridge to motor-vehicle traffic. The ride is set for Saturday morning, April 25, with registration opening this Tuesday (February…

Questions about zoning changes? Get answers Tuesday
As we’ve reported, zoning changes are leading to neighborhood changes, primarily more housing, as “single-family” zoning no longer exists. The city has incorporated zoning changes as required by the state, and more are on the way, with the recent introduction of what the city calls the the Centers and Corridors…
